How they compare

Slovenia currently reports 1,122 1000 USD against 814 1000 USD in Romania, a difference of 308 1000 USD.

That makes Slovenia's figure about 1.4 times Romania's.

The two have swapped places 7 times across 22 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Romania ahead.

Romania ranks 15th and Slovenia ranks 13th of 65 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Romania averaged higher in 2 and Slovenia in 1.
